Energy balance

Consume More Calories Than You Burn Daily

The first goal is to create a positive energy balance, meaning that your calorie intake is higher than your calorie expenditure. For skinny people with poor absorption, the weight gain strategy needs to maintain a surplus of 300 to 500 kcal per day. An effective way to do this is to increase the calorie content of each meal with energy-dense foods such as avocados, olive oil, brown rice, oats, weight gain milk, or whole grain cereal powder.

Eat Multiple Meals Per Day

For skinny individuals with poor absorption, one effective way to gain weight quickly is to divide meals into smaller portions combined with increased nutrition in each serving. Instead of just eating 3 main meals, eat more meals throughout the day so that energy intake is spread evenly, helping to maintain stable blood sugar levels and supporting a smooth metabolism.

When energy is continuously supplied, nutrient absorption becomes optimally efficient, thereby leading to significant weight improvement and supporting sustainable weight gain for skinny individuals. Ideally, daily food intake should be divided into 6 meals: 3 main meals and 3 snacks, with just enough food to avoid overloading the digestive system.

Do Not Skip Meals, Especially Breakfast

Skinny individuals aiming to improve their weight must absolutely not skip meals, especially breakfast. When hungry, the body utilizes energy reserves from muscles, liver, and other vital tissues. This makes it even harder for skinny people to gain weight due to the loss of necessary lean mass.

Meanwhile, breakfast plays a crucial role in kickstarting metabolism, providing energy, boosting health, and preparing the body for all daily activities. Therefore, ensure you don’t skip any meals throughout the day, especially breakfast, to build a strong physical foundation and achieve optimal weight gain results.

Why Do Skinny People Have Difficulty Absorbing Nutrients?

In reality, many factors, from body physiology to lifestyle, directly impact the ability to convert food into nutrients. Understanding the causes will help you identify the right effective and sustainable weight gain methods:

Poorly Functioning Digestive System Leads to Poor Nutrient Absorption

People with a weak digestive system often struggle to break down and absorb nutrients. Even if food is consumed sufficiently, it may not be converted into energy. This condition occurs in individuals with chronic digestive disorders, enzyme deficiencies, or poorly functioning small intestines. Additionally, if you frequently experience bloating, constipation, or diarrhea after eating, it is likely that your digestive system is experiencing problems.

High Metabolism Causes the Body to Burn Energy Continuously

Some chronically skinny individuals have a naturally high metabolic rate. This causes their bodies to burn more calories than average, even at rest. No matter how much they eat, it’s not enough to compensate for the calories expended. If you belong to this group, gaining weight will require double the effort compared to others.

Irregular and Unscientific Eating Habits

Irregular eating times, skipping breakfast, or eating too little are common reasons why skinny individuals cannot improve their weight. Some people eat a lot in one meal and then fast for subsequent meals or snack instead of having main meals. This causes the body to lack stability in receiving essential calories and nutrients.

Sedentary Lifestyle and Poor Quality Sleep

Skinny individuals who are sedentary often have sluggish circulatory and digestive systems. Prolonged sitting, late nights, and chronic stress also affect nutrient absorption. Sleep plays a significant role in body recovery and promoting growth hormones; without enough sleep, the weight gain process will be interrupted.

Psychological Factors and Underlying Medical Conditions

Prolonged stress, depression, or excessive anxiety can cause eating disorders. Skinny individuals often do not feel hungry or lose their appetite. Additionally, certain conditions related to the thyroid, liver, intestines, or parasitic infections can also reduce nutrient absorption.

Sample Weight Gain Meal Plan for People with Poor Absorption

A weight gain meal plan is not simply about eating a lot. Chronically skinny individuals need to adhere to a scientific eating schedule, where protein,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ates must be present in every main meal and snack.

  • Divide into 5–6 meals/day: helps prevent stomach overload and supports stable digestive enzyme activity.
  • Prioritize calorie-dense and high-energy foods: such as avocado, bananas, cheese, cereals, oats, eggs, fatty fish.
  • Combine beverages that aid digestion and increase absorption: smoothies, weight gain milk, protein-fortified soy milk, bone broth.
  • Gradually increase portion sizes each week: to allow the body to adapt to higher calorie levels.

Breakfast (6:30 AM – 7:00 AM)

  • 1 bowl of oatmeal cooked with unsweetened fresh milk, topped with peanut butter
  • 1 ripe banana
  • 1 glass (200ml) of weight gain milk

Mid-morning Snack (9:30 AM)

  • 1 glass of avocado smoothie (ripe avocado + condensed milk + fresh milk)
  • 5 – 7 walnuts

Lunch (12:00 PM)

  • 1 bowl of white rice (or soft brown rice)
  • 1 portion of pan-seared chicken breast
  • Boiled green vegetables (broccoli, carrots)
  • 1 bowl of yam and minced pork soup
  • 1 glass of fresh apple juice

Afternoon Snack (3:00 PM)

  • 1 slice of whole-grain bread with fried egg
  • 1 glass of nut milk (almond or walnut milk)

Dinner (6:30 PM)

  • 1 bowl of rice + pan-seared salmon with honey sauce
  • Vegetable salad with olive oil dressing
  • 1 bowl of seaweed soup with lean pork
  • 1 fresh avocado eaten directly

Before-bed Snack (9:00 PM)

  • 1 glass of hot milk mixed with cereal powder
  • 2 rice cakes

Important Notes and Mistakes When Gaining Weight for Poor Absorbers

Below are important notes and common mistakes that skinny individuals with poor absorption should avoid to improve weight, increase nutrient absorption, and maintain overall health:

Not building a scientific weight gain diet is the most common mistake. Many people think that just eating a lot will lead to weight gain. However, if the diet lacks sufficient protein, healthy fats, or B vitamins, the body will not be able to absorb and convert them into muscle or energy.

Skipping breakfast or eating at irregular times also disrupts metabolic processes. This imbalances a scientific eating schedule, reducing calorie absorption efficiency, especially for individuals with weak digestive systems.

Eating too many fried foods and sugary items only increases visceral fat without helping build muscle or achieve healthy weight gain. Energy-dense foods must be carefully selected, prioritizing protein-rich snacks, various cereal powders, whey protein, and weight gain milk instead of fast food.

Not combining muscle-building exercises is a major oversight. Skinny individuals with poor absorption often neglect physical activity, leading to a sedentary lifestyle that negatively impacts energy metabolism and appetite. Gentle exercises help stimulate digestion and improve the metabolic system.

Gaining weight too quickly with uncontrolled supplements can cause digestive disorders, increasing fat but not muscle. Some cases may experience protein absorption allergies or issues like reverse absorption in the small intestine, which are not detected in time.

Lack of sleep and prolonged stress disrupt hormones, affecting hunger and absorption capabilities. Individuals aiming to gain weight need to get 7-8 hours of sleep daily and manage stress with appropriate relaxation methods.
